I am looking for a Procurement Solution Consultant with extensive SAP PP experience to join a finance transformation programme. This will allow you to take on a senior role leading the shaping and delivery of the sourcing and procurement solution in collaboration with the Design Authority, Product Owner and procurement and finance domain stakeholders.

  • Lead the shaping of the procurement solution across SAP S/4HANA Sourcing and Procurement, ensuring coherence across the procurement stack and alignment with the wider SAP product suite in use on the project.
  • Act as the major owner of Source-to-Pay design (sourcing, contract management, operational procurement, supplier collaboration and supplier invoice management), and as the supporting partner on the Order-to-Cash and Record-to-Report boundaries led by the Sales, Distribution and Logistics and Finance Solution Consultants, ensuring supplier master data, three-way matching and spend data integrity are properly embedded in the cross-domain solution.
  • Facilitate Fit-to-Standard workshops for the procurement domain, holding the adopt-not-adapt line and surfacing genuine standard-process gaps for Design Authority resolution.
